Add ¼ cup of … greyhound hiring processYou can freeze zucchini whole without blanching it. This will save on time but it will not last as long in the freezer. It is recommended you blanch the zucchini first by putting it into boiling water and then dipping it in iced water to slow the production of enzymes that will cause loss of flavor, color, and texture.
